Output e520fc24cd27795fc7f1eaf6f02e32fc9adbda8a933b7af8f16809504129ec16:0

value
37744851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c8c0782a4bd752f27d1d568a60db306dae01d2 OP_EQUAL
address
3HiUfbXDrUs2ePBYab3KfuWXa9kKQd2cU5
transaction
e520fc24cd27795fc7f1eaf6f02e32fc9adbda8a933b7af8f16809504129ec16
confirmations
350234
spent
true